Tucked within the distinguished and historic setting of Barrow Court Estate, No. 7 is a charming Grade II* listed terraced home offering a wonderfully rare combination of period character, beautiful surroundings and a genuine sense of community. Set amongst expansive gardens and overlooking the rolling Somerset countryside, life here feels wonderfully removed from the everyday, while still offering the comfort and practicality of a thoughtfully updated home.

The approach is part of the experience. A picturesque, tree-lined driveway winds its way through the estate before arriving at a secluded south-facing courtyard, where No. 7 sits quietly amongst its historic neighbours.

Inside, the character of the building immediately becomes apparent. Arranged over three floors, the property retains a wealth of original features, including elegant stone mullioned leaded windows, beautifully carved fireplaces and exposed architectural details that reflect the craftsmanship of its heritage.

The ground floor has been thoughtfully updated for modern living, centred around a beautifully renovated Timbercraft kitchen with integrated Neff appliances and a timeless neutral finish. The breakfast bar creates a relaxed spot for coffee or conversation, while the open-plan arrangement provides ample flexibility for dining or a comfortable snug. A useful cloakroom completes this floor, incorporating space for a washing machine and additional storage.

From the entrance hall, the staircase rises to the first floor, where the accommodation is currently arranged as a generous living room. A magnificent open fireplace creates an inviting focal point, complemented by views across the courtyard. Alongside is the family bathroom. This versatile space could easily be adapted to suit individual requirements, offering the option of a substantial third bedroom, allowing the property to function as either a two-bedroom home with two reception spaces or a three-bedroom home with a single main downstairs living space.

The top floor provides a peaceful bedroom retreat. An original fireplace sits within the landing, while the principal bedroom enjoys an impressive vaulted ceiling, exposed beams, bespoke storage and a private ensuite. A further well-proportioned bedroom completes the accommodation.
